it's been a long time since i've been on here, but for those that may have had the chassis thin going on with ltsa and body swapping, the LTSA deem the chassis to be the body not the body itself! so you can have any hilux body on a chassis but you have to swap the body tag over to the new body to suit the chassis so as the two match. there is another way also but i wont put that on here!!
